Oracle如何查看impdp正在执行的内容
1. 今天进行数据库备份恢复 一直卡住 找了一下 公司另外一个部门的方神提供了一个方法连查看 具体在做什么操作:
2. 现象. impdp 到一个地方直接卡住不动 具体位置 view
这个地方足足卡住了 50min
3. 方法
查看一下任务信息
SELECT owner_name, job_name, operation, job_mode, state, attached_sessions FROM dba_datapump_jobs;
效果为:
4. 另外开个窗口执行命令:
impdp system/Test6530@127.0.0.1/ora19cpdb attach=SYS_IMPORT_SCHEMA_01
5. 效果 status
总结
以上就是这篇文章的全部内容了,希望本文的内容对大家的学习或者工作具有一定的参考学习价值,谢谢大家对我们的支持。
相关推荐
-
oracle impdp network_link参数使用介绍
一.环境说明 源数据库: IP地址:192.168.137.100 sid:catalog 用户名:rman 密码:rman 目标数据库: IP地址:192.168.137.101 sid:orcl 用户名:rman 密码:rman 二.在目标数据库上创建到源数据库的tnsname 用oracle用户登录目标数据库,修改 $ORACLE_HOME/network/admin/tnsnames.ora文件,增加如下内容 复制代码 代码如下: catalog = (DESCRIPTION = (AD
-
Oracle如何查看impdp正在执行的内容
1. 今天进行数据库备份恢复 一直卡住 找了一下 公司另外一个部门的方神提供了一个方法连查看 具体在做什么操作: 2. 现象. impdp 到一个地方直接卡住不动 具体位置 view 这个地方足足卡住了 50min 3. 方法 查看一下任务信息 SELECT owner_name, job_name, operation, job_mode, state, attached_sessions FROM dba_datapump_jobs; 效果为: 4. 另外开个窗口执行命令: impdp s
-
探讨:Oracle数据库查看一个进程是如何执行相关的实际SQL语句
Oracle数据库查看一个进程是如何执行相关的实际SQL语句 复制代码 代码如下: SELECT b.sql_text, sid, serial#, osuser, machine FROM v$session a, v$sqlarea b WHERE a.sql_address = b.address; 查询前台发出的SQL语句. 复制代码 代码如下: select user_name,sql_text from v$open_cursor where sid in (
-
如何查看Django ORM执行的SQL语句的实现
Django ORM对数据库操作的封装相当完善,日常大部分数据库操作都可以通过ORM实现.但django将查询过程隐藏在了后台,这在开发时可能会略显晦涩,并且使用方式不当还会造成开销过大. 那么如何查看django何时执行了什么sql语句呢?答案是使用Logging. 先直接上方法,在settings.py中加入LOGGING选项,调整logging等级为DEBUG即可: LOGGING = { 'version': 1, 'disable_existing_loggers': False, '
-
python查看文件大小和文件夹内容的方法
一旦有办法处理文件路径,就可以开始搜集特定文件和文件夹的信息.os.path 模块提供了一些函数,用于查看文件的字节数以及给定文件夹中的文件和子文件夹. • 调用 os.path.getsize(path)将返回 path 参数中文件的字节数. • 调用 os.listdir(path)将返回文件名字符串的列表,包含 path 参数中的每个文件(请注意,这个函数在 os 模块中,而不是 os.path). 下面是我在交互式环境中尝试这些函数的结果: >>> os.path.getsize
-
ORACLE数据库查看执行计划的方法
一.什么是执行计划(explain plan) 执行计划:一条查询语句在ORACLE中的执行过程或访问路径的描述. 二.如何查看执行计划 1: 在PL/SQL下按F5查看执行计划.第三方工具toad等. 很多人以为PL/SQL的执行计划只能看到基数.优化器.耗费等基本信息,其实这个可以在PL/SQL工具里面设置的.可以看到很多其它信息,如下所示 2: 在SQL*PLUS(PL/SQL的命令窗口和SQL窗口均可)下执行下面步骤 复制代码 代码如下: SQL>EXPLAIN PLAN FOR SEL
-
Oracle基础多条sql执行在中间的语句出现错误时的控制方式
多条sql执行时如果在中间的语句出现错误,后续会不会直接执行,如何进行设定,以及其他数据库诸如Mysql是如何对应的,这篇文章将会进行简单的整理和说明. 环境准备 使用Oracle的精简版创建docker方式的demo环境,详细可参看: https://www.jb51.net/article/153533.htm 多行语句的正常执行 对上篇文章创建的两个字段的学生信息表,正常添加三条数据,详细如下: # sqlplus system/liumiao123@XE <<EOF > desc
-
Oracle中查看慢查询进度的脚本分享
Oracle一个大事务的SQL往往不知道运行到了哪里,可以使用如下SQL查看执行进度. 复制代码 代码如下: set linesize 400; set pagesize 400; col sql_text format a100; col opname format a15; SELECT se.sid, opname, TRUNC (sofar / totalwork * 100, 2) pct_work, elapsed_seconds
-
Oracle中使用DBMS_XPLAN处理执行计划详解
DBMS_XPLAN是Oracle提供的一个用于查看SQL计划,包括执行计划和解释计划的包:在以前查看SQL执行计划的时候,我都是使用set autotrace命令,不过现在看来,DBMS_XPLAN包给出了更加简化的获取和显示计划的方式. 这5个函数分别对应不同的显示计划的方式,DBMS_XPLAN包不仅可以获取解释计划,它还可以用来输出存储在AWR,SQL调试集,缓存的SQL游标,以及SQL基线中的语句计划,实现如上的功能,通常会用到一下5个方法: 1.DISPLAY 2.DISPLAY_A
-
Postgresql 查看SQL语句执行效率的操作
Explain命令在解决数据库性能上是第一推荐使用命令,大部分的性能问题可以通过此命令来简单的解决,Explain可以用来查看 SQL 语句的执行效 果,可以帮助选择更好的索引和优化查询语句,写出更好的优化语句. Explain语法: explain select - from - [where ...] 例如: explain select * from dual; 这里有一个简单的例子,如下: EXPLAIN SELECT * FROM tenk1; QUERY PLAN ---------
-
Oracle中sql语句如何执行日志查询
目录 Oracle sql语句执行日志查询 Oracle查询某天sql执行记录 Oracle sql语句执行日志查询 在Oracle数据中,我们经常编写sql语句,有时我们会编写一些特别长的sql语句,而有一些意外导致sql消失,从而出现长时间写的sql,但是需要重新辨析,我们可以使用查询语句通过时间定位sql. 从而找到: select FIRST_LOAD_TIME,LENGTH(SQL_FULLTEXT),SQL_FULLTEXT from v$sql where SQL_FULLTEXT
随机推荐
- Oracle中使用触发器(trigger)和序列(sequence)模拟实现自增列实例
- 利用angular.copy取消变量的双向绑定与解析
- js data日期初始化的5种方法
- JS简单获取当前日期时间的方法(如:2017-03-29 11:41:10 星期四)
- 简单介绍Java编程中的线程池
- Java实现获取客户端真实IP方法小结
- python列表操作使用示例分享
- python实现逻辑回归的方法示例
- Asp.NET 随机码生成基类(随机字母,随机数字,随机字母+数字)
- HTML5实现微信拍摄上传照片功能
- python装饰器使用方法实例
- Android模拟器无法启动,报错:Cannot set up guest memory ‘android_arm’ Invalid argument的解决方法
- js判断浏览器版本以及浏览器内核的方法
- java实现CSV 字段分割
- java中switch case语句需要加入break的原因解析
- TextView长按复制的实现方法(总结)
- <b>一些常用的php函数</b>
- Python实现的插入排序算法原理与用法实例分析
- SQLiteStudio优雅调试Android手机数据库Sqlite(推荐)
- Android仿京东分类模块左侧分类条目效果